Twin Peaks Guest Ranch
Booking.com
Frequent questions
In what town is the facility located Twin Peaks Guest Ranch?
The Twin Peaks Guest Ranch facility is located in the town of Salmon, and the exact address is: 199 Twin Peaks Ranch Road, Salmon, ID 83467, United States of America.
How can I check available dates in accommodation Twin Peaks Guest Ranch?
You can check available dates on our partner's website - there you can also make a reservation in the Twin Peaks Guest Ranch facility.
How much is accommodation in the Twin Peaks Guest Ranch?
The most up-to-date price list for object Twin Peaks Guest Ranch can be found on our partner's website - check the prices >>
What other accommodation can I find nearby?
You will find the following other accommodation facilities nearby: Bear Country Inn (at distance: 26.35 km),
The Stagecoach Inn (at distance: 26.61 km),
Super 8 by Wyndham Salmon (at distance: 26.61 km),
Wildflower condo (at distance: 141.92 km),
Localities nearby

Contact
199 Twin Peaks Ranch Road
ID 83467 Idaho
USA
Similar accommodations
Bear Country Inn

Bear Country Inn features accommodations in Salmon. Private parking can be arranged at an extra charge. At the hotel guests are welcome to take advantage of an
Distance: (26.35 km)
The Stagecoach Inn

You're eligible for a Genius discount at The Stagecoach Inn! To save at this property, all you have to do is sign in. Featuring an outdoor pool and hot tub, thi
Distance: (26.61 km)
Super 8 by Wyndham Salmon

Located within the Salmon Challis National Fores and less than 5 minutes’ walk from the Salmon River, this motel offers free Wi-Fi. It features a 24-hour recep
Distance: (26.61 km)
Wildflower condo

Wildflower condo is located in Sun Valley and offers a restaurant, an outdoor swimming pool and a fitness center. Boasting free private parking, the apartment i
Distance: (141.92 km)